Judiciary, Chair
The House Judiciary Committee considers a wide variety of subjects
relating to civil and criminal law, including issues involving
commercial law, torts, probate, guardianships, drunk driving, courts and
judicial administration; and family law issues such as marriage,
marriage dissolution, child support and adoption.
General Government Appropriations
The House General Government Appropriations Committee considers
issues relating to funding of general government, natural resources and
corrections programs and agencies and makes funding recommendations to
the Ways and Means Committee. In addition, the committee considers bills
relating to general government, natural resources and corrections with
limited fiscal impact.
Health Care and Wellness
The House Health Care and Wellness Committee considers a broad range
of issues relating to the provision of physical and mental health care
services and strategies to promote better health. Health care service
issues include the licensing and regulation of health care facilities
(such as hospitals, trauma care centers, and long-term care facilities)
and the credentialing of health care providers (such as doctors, nurses,
chiropractors, and mental health professionals). The committee also
regulates pharmacies and pharmaceutical drugs, and has oversight and
regulatory responsibility for state and local public health programs.
The committee also considers issues relating to the accessibility and
affordability of health care in both the private health insurance market
and public health programs such as medicaid and the basic health plan.
